About The Book

This Book is a graphic face to face account of encounters with unusual men and women- the faith-healers, the flesh mortifiers the mystics who materialize ash and honey, black magicians, yogis who stop their pulse and heart beat, death defiers who get buried alive and live to tell the tale, spiritual séance mediums who act as transmitters between the living and the dead, and much more.

Some mysteries of the Universe are beyond man’s comprehension, yet they never fail to ignite his curiosity. The very fact that these psychic phenomena cannot be exhibited by everyone, adds to their peculiar allure.

This book is an objective sally into this realm. What gives some mortals these super-powers?

Science has not yet found all the answers. Hear what the mystics and miracle men say in their own versions of what exactly happens to them on the psychic, physical and metaphysical planes, when they are going through these experiences

 

About The Author

Mayah Balse is a successful writer who has penned over a thousand articles and stories for leading magazines and newspapers like the "Times of India", "Fernina", "Eve's Weekly" and "Reader's Digest", among others. She has authored novels like "Just a Matter of Mistresses", "The Singer", "The Sensuous Saint", "The Stranger", "Indiscreet" and "The Cannibal" as well as non, fiction "Encounters with Men of Miracles" and "The Indian Female: Attitude towards Sex". In addition, she has worked in an advertising agency, visualized comics and comic strips and written children's books. She has also written for the BBC. She lives in Mumbai and has scripted senals for television - some memorable ones being Campus, Amanat, Kumkum Challenge and Dekh Bhai Dekh. These have been telecast on both Doordarshan and private satellite channels like Zee TV, Sony and Star Plus.

She is married to an Indian Air Force Officer, Who is now retired. They have two daughters.

 

Introduction

Psychic experiences are more common than one supposes. Almost every third person I encountered in the normal course of dav-to-day living had had direct experiences with ghosts or spirits; had been influenced by a mystic, or cured by a faith, healer.

Whenever I mentioned my subject, I got strange reactions from people. For instance, Mr. S.O. Raghu who had spent five years in Tibet and Sikkim and had some direct as well as indirect experiences with the occult, asked me: "Why have you chosen this subject?" "Why not?" I replied. "It is fascinating."

"It is strange," he said. "Being drawn to esoteric subjects is almost as if it were preordained." Some mysteries of the Universe are beyond .man's comprehension, yet they never fail to ignite curiosity.

What is the difference between mysticism and magic? Is faith, healing a fact?

Can there be clairvoyance? Is it possible to recall past births? Do dead men tell tales? What happens in a trance state? Can a man survive living burial? Do meditation techniques arouse a fourth dimension? Can black magic kill? What happens when you die? Is reincarnation a fact? Does the mind have power over matter? Can psychic healing cure?

Science has not yet found all the answers. But, one can at least hear those who have had such experiences and what happen to them when they are passing through the psychic, paranormal and metaphysical planes. A face-to-face encounter with them may not make you a greater spiritual person, but will definitely make you a more thoughtful one.

This is a compilation of my experiences with such phenomena spanning several years and which I wish to share with you.
